As discussed on IRC, I'm adding a new location to find user packages in

/data/userpools/ . Only buildd has been moved, but other users could be
moved over (and symlinked) at will. A user could have two separate
pools, but they'll have to sort what happens themselves.
......@@ -41,6 +41,9 @@ upstreamSecurityMirror=$stagingDir/debian-security
# Location of our temporary mirrors
# Where are user pool (package pool) directories?
# ls -d is run on this, so the *'s are needed (for now)
userpools="/home/* /data/userpools/*"
# Archive signing key
......@@ -82,7 +85,7 @@ copy_overlays(){
echo "$codename: Building per user overlays."
mkdir -p $base_dir/pool/overlays/$codename$subsuite
for home_dir in $(ls -d /home/*); do
for home_dir in $(ls -d $userpools); do
user=$(basename $home_dir)
# Extra level /packages/ because else subsuites would get
# added to the base suite.
